The teacher

839 Words
When they all were in their beds, Hannah teached the bigger ones two different classes, today she had chosen basic math for the 7-11 year olds. They struggled with division, however they had become fairly good with subtraction and addition. While she taught them math, the teens would read in the books she brought today. After an hour the time was around 8pm and she tugged the kids to bed. Doing the same as she did for the little ones. She read them a story, tugged them into bed and told them “the world needs you, your smile will brighten the day of a lonely one, your voice will help a lost one and you are worth everything. If you don’t get treated right don’t give up. We all have our purpose in this world and so do you. Always be kind and gentle, and never give up”. She kissed them on their forehead blew out the candles around them and went to the teens. Today she had decided to teach them about how the outside world functioned. She had borrowed books on politics, the town history, and she had also gotten a lot of newspapers from different stands with free newspapers. “This town, is called the high moon city. It has a special lore. She told them“It is said, that in the beginning of the world, the Moon Goddess choose this city to be the center of peace between different night creatures. Werewolfs, vampires and witches, ruled by a mighty King and his graceful Queen. They would rule it with honesty, and dignity. The King and Queen would be filled with love and power to each other that would spread to the entire world making the peace last forever. However, a human named Alik, didn’t want the creatures of the night to work together afraid that they would destroy the humans, he began hunting down the night creatures, killing them one by one. One day he found the Queen in an alley caring for some poor human children. He called her name, and made her look at him, as he drew his sword and stabbed her heart. With her whispering “don’t be afraid, be gentle and kind” she fell down to the pavement and died. As soon as that happened, the sky went black, and the Loudest most terrifying was heard in the entire city, it was filled with pain, and everyone young and old, human, wolf, witch or vampire, all felt the pain, down their spines. See the king and the queen was mated, she was the king’s half, if she cried, he cried, if she laughed, he did. When Alik killed his Queen, who balanced him out all good, that had ever been in the king’s heart disappeared, and now only evil and anger was left. The King who was enraged began killing everything, wolfs, vampire, humans, witches in the search for the murderer of the queen. He roamed day and night in the streets, and the blood of innocent beings was everywhere. A war burst out between all races and the lore says that the war is still going on today and will never end unless the king finds his Queen” After the story Hannah gave them a minute to think. Then Toby said “how many of the creatures still exists” another one asked “why did the Queen say be gentle and kind when she died? Hannah answered, “I am not sure, but my theory is that she said so, because being gentle and kind, is something our hearts control, and maybe she could see the children she was caring for was afraid or Alik, he killed her because he was scared on the behalf of the humans or maybe she knew what would happen to the King?. It could also be because of all of them”. They all sat and wondered about the story. "Remember, it is only a lore", Hannah said moving on with the lecture "so in this city, we are split in different parts with different leaders…" and she forwarded with how the city structure was, who ruled where, who the king of the land was and so on. When the clock struck 10 pm they all went to bed, and again she walked to each of their beds, kissed them on the forehead and said ”the world needs you, your smile will brighten the day of a lonely one, your voice will help a lost one and you are worth everything. If you don’t get treated right don’t give up. We all have our purpose in this world and so do you. Always be kind and gentle, and never give up”Toby was the last one she whispered into his ear “everything will be okay kiddo it will. She blew out the rest of the candles and went into her own bed.
